Finish!
Remember this little piece? I decided to make a little almost 16" x 20" Walhain using that little bird embroideries. I appliquéd them on to some Essex Linen, And then have a lot of fun with the machine quilting.
Being such a small piece, it was easy to maneuver on my little sewing machine. I used a heavy thread to stitch in the ditch around all the little hexagons, and then tried out my woodgrain pattern on the rest of the background.
